var MouseWheelClassifier = /** @class */ (function () {
function MouseWheelClassifier() {
this._capacity = 5;
this._memory = [];
this._front = -1;
this._rear = -1;
}
MouseWheelClassifier.prototype.isPhysicalMouseWheel = function () {
if (this._front === -1 && this._rear === -1) {
// no elements
return false;
}
// 0.5 * last + 0.25 * before last + 0.125 * before before last + ...
var remainingInfluence = 1;
var score = 0;
var iteration = 1;
var index = this._rear;
do {
var influence = (index === this._front ? remainingInfluence : Math.pow(2, -iteration));
remainingInfluence -= influence;
score += this._memory[index].score * influence;
if (index === this._front) {
break;
}
index = (this._capacity + index - 1) % this._capacity;
iteration++;
} while (true);
return (score <= 0.5);
};
MouseWheelClassifier.prototype.accept = function (timestamp, deltaX, deltaY) {
var item = new MouseWheelClassifierItem(timestamp, deltaX, deltaY);
item.score = this._computeScore(item);
if (this._front === -1 && this._rear === -1) {
this._memory[0] = item;
this._front = 0;
this._rear = 0;
}
else {
this._rear = (this._rear + 1) % this._capacity;
if (this._rear === this._front) {
// Drop oldest
this._front = (this._front + 1) % this._capacity;
}
this._memory[this._rear] = item;
}
};
/**
* A score between 0 and 1 for `item`.
* - a score towards 0 indicates that the source appears to be a physical mouse wheel
* - a score towards 1 indicates that the source appears to be a touchpad or magic mouse, etc.
*/
MouseWheelClassifier.prototype._computeScore = function (item) {
if (Math.abs(item.deltaX) > 0 && Math.abs(item.deltaY) > 0) {
// both axes exercised => definitely not a physical mouse wheel
return 1;
}
var score = 0.5;
var prev = (this._front === -1 && this._rear === -1 ? null : this._memory[this._rear]);
if (prev) {
// const deltaT = item.timestamp - prev.timestamp;
// if (deltaT < 1000 / 30) {
// // sooner than X times per second => indicator that this is not a physical mouse wheel
// score += 0.25;
// }
// if (item.deltaX === prev.deltaX && item.deltaY === prev.deltaY) {
// // equal amplitude => indicator that this is a physical mouse wheel
// score -= 0.25;
// }
}
if (Math.abs(item.deltaX - Math.round(item.deltaX)) > 0 || Math.abs(item.deltaY - Math.round(item.deltaY)) > 0) {
// non-integer deltas => indicator that this is not a physical mouse wheel
score += 0.25;
}
return Math.min(Math.max(score, 0), 1);
};
MouseWheelClassifier.INSTANCE = new MouseWheelClassifier();
return MouseWheelClassifier;
}());
export { MouseWheelClassifier };

// -------------------- mouse wheel scrolling --------------------
AbstractScrollableElement.prototype._setListeningToMouseWheel = function (shouldListen) {
var _this = this;
var isListening = (this._mouseWheelToDispose.length > 0);
if (isListening === shouldListen) {
// No change
return;
}
// Stop listening (if necessary)
this._mouseWheelToDispose = dispose(this._mouseWheelToDispose);
// Start listening (if necessary)
if (shouldListen) {
var onMouseWheel = function (browserEvent) {
var e = new StandardMouseWheelEvent(browserEvent);
_this._onMouseWheel(e);
};
this._mouseWheelToDispose.push(dom.addDisposableListener(this._listenOnDomNode, 'mousewheel', onMouseWheel));
this._mouseWheelToDispose.push(dom.addDisposableListener(this._listenOnDomNode, 'DOMMouseScroll', onMouseWheel));
}
};
AbstractScrollableElement.prototype._onMouseWheel = function (e) {
var _a;
var classifier = MouseWheelClassifier.INSTANCE;
if (SCROLL_WHEEL_SMOOTH_SCROLL_ENABLED) {
classifier.accept(Date.now(), e.deltaX, e.deltaY);
}
// console.log(`${Date.now()}, ${e.deltaY}, ${e.deltaX}`);
if (e.deltaY || e.deltaX) {
var deltaY = e.deltaY * this._options.mouseWheelScrollSensitivity;
var deltaX = e.deltaX * this._options.mouseWheelScrollSensitivity;
if (this._options.flipAxes) {
_a = [deltaX, deltaY], deltaY = _a[0], deltaX = _a[1];
}
// Convert vertical scrolling to horizontal if shift is held, this
// is handled at a higher level on Mac
var shiftConvert = !platform.isMacintosh && e.browserEvent && e.browserEvent.shiftKey;
if ((this._options.scrollYToX || shiftConvert) && !deltaX) {
deltaX = deltaY;
deltaY = 0;
}
var futureScrollPosition = this._scrollable.getFutureScrollPosition();
var desiredScrollPosition = {};
if (deltaY) {
var desiredScrollTop = futureScrollPosition.scrollTop - SCROLL_WHEEL_SENSITIVITY * deltaY;
this._verticalScrollbar.writeScrollPosition(desiredScrollPosition, desiredScrollTop);
}
if (deltaX) {
var desiredScrollLeft = futureScrollPosition.scrollLeft - SCROLL_WHEEL_SENSITIVITY * deltaX;
this._horizontalScrollbar.writeScrollPosition(desiredScrollPosition, desiredScrollLeft);
}
// Check that we are scrolling towards a location which is valid
desiredScrollPosition = this._scrollable.validateScrollPosition(desiredScrollPosition);
if (futureScrollPosition.scrollLeft !== desiredScrollPosition.scrollLeft || futureScrollPosition.scrollTop !== desiredScrollPosition.scrollTop) {
var canPerformSmoothScroll = (SCROLL_WHEEL_SMOOTH_SCROLL_ENABLED
&& this._options.mouseWheelSmoothScroll
&& classifier.isPhysicalMouseWheel());
if (canPerformSmoothScroll) {
this._scrollable.setScrollPositionSmooth(desiredScrollPosition);
}
else {
this._scrollable.setScrollPositionNow(desiredScrollPosition);
}
this._shouldRender = true;
}
}
if (this._options.alwaysConsumeMouseWheel || this._shouldRender) {
e.preventDefault();
e.stopPropagation();
}
};
